'Netherlands Queen committed to help Pakistan promote digital identity'.

DAVOS -- Queen Maxima of the Netherlands has affirmed her commitment to helping Pakistan promote digital identity as a public good.

This was stated by Tania Aidrus, chief of Prime Minister Imran Khan's Digital Pakistan Vision campaign, who met the Queen of the Netherlands on the sidelines of the World Economic Forum (WEF) summit being held in Davos.

In a tweet, she said: 'Great seeing Queen Maxima #UNSGSA for #FinancialInclusion at #Davos2020.'

'She talked fondly about her last visit to Pakistan and is deeply committed to helping us promote digital identity as a public good and bridging the gender digital divide in Pakistan.'
